The Hydroelectric Power Technician is the guardian of the dams, maintaining the colossal machines that harness the raw, terrifying power of water to generate massive amounts of clean electricity. In regions with vast river networks, hydroelectricity is the absolute backbone of the power grid. These technicians work deep inside the concrete walls of towering dams, ensuring that the massive water turbines and generators operate with absolute precision and safety.

A typical day for a technician is physically demanding and deeply technical. The environment is incredibly loud, echoing with the roar of millions of gallons of water rushing through penstocks. They conduct daily visual and mechanical inspections of the massive turbine blades, checking for cavitation damage caused by water pressure. They monitor the hydraulic systems that control the massive spillway gates, ensuring they can be opened instantly during a flood emergency. When a generator requires maintenance, they use heavy cranes and specialized tools to dismantle and repair components that weigh several tons.

This career appeals to those who are awestruck by massive infrastructure and love heavy mechanical engineering. It offers a unique lifestyle, as many hydroelectric dams are located in remote, beautiful mountainous regions, far away from the chaos of the city. The role provides ironclad job security, as dams are designed to operate for over a century, and requires dedicated experts to keep the mechanical heart of the power grid beating.

The Journey to Become One

1. Diploma in Engineering

3 Years

Gain essential skills in mechanical engineering, fluid dynamics, and basic electricity.

2. Junior Maintenance Technician

2 to 3 Years

Start with the basics: greasing bearings, painting rust, and assisting senior mechanics during massive overhauls.

3. Hydro Turbine Specialist

3 to 6 Years

Become an expert in diagnosing complex vibrations and repairing the intricate blades of the water turbine.

4. Dam Operations Supervisor

5 to 10 Years

Manage the shift crew, coordinate spillway releases, and ensure the entire plant meets production targets.

5. Plant Manager

Lifetime

Take ultimate responsibility for the entire dam, managing safety, budgets, and grid coordination.

Minimum Academic Reality Check

Undergraduate

Diploma or Bachelor Degree in Mechanical, Electrical, or Mechatronics Engineering.

Certifications

Heavy Machinery Operation, High Voltage Safety, and Confined Space Entry certifications are highly valued.

Mindset

Must be physically fit, completely comfortable in loud, claustrophobic industrial environments, and deeply safety conscious.

Tech Literacy

Proficient in reading complex mechanical blueprints and operating diagnostic vibration software.

Salary Intelligence

Entry Level RM 2,500 - RM 3,800
Mid Level RM 5,000 - RM 7,500
Senior Level RM 9,500+
